网络性能监测有哪些常见方法?

在当今这个信息化时代,网络已经成为人们生活、工作的重要组成部分。网络性能的稳定与否直接影响到用户体验。为了确保网络性能的稳定,网络性能监测成为一项至关重要的工作。那么,网络性能监测有哪些常见方法呢?本文将为您详细介绍。

一、网络性能监测的基本概念

网络性能监测是指对网络运行状态进行实时监控,以发现潜在问题,确保网络稳定运行。网络性能监测的主要内容包括:网络带宽、延迟、丢包率、链路状态等。

二、常见网络性能监测方法

  1. SNMP(简单网络管理协议)

SNMP是一种广泛使用的网络管理协议,通过SNMP协议,网络管理员可以远程监控网络设备的状态。SNMP监测方法包括:

  • SNMP Get:获取网络设备的状态信息;
  • SNMP Set:修改网络设备的状态;
  • SNMP Trap:接收网络设备发送的报警信息。

  1. Ping测试

Ping测试是一种常用的网络性能监测方法,通过向目标设备发送ICMP请求,并接收响应,可以判断网络连接是否正常、延迟和丢包率等。


  1. Traceroute

Traceroute是一种用于诊断网络路径问题的工具,通过跟踪数据包在网络中的传输路径,可以找出网络中的瓶颈和故障点。


  1. 流量监测

流量监测是指对网络流量进行实时监控,以了解网络使用情况。流量监测方法包括:

  • NetFlow:NetFlow是一种网络流量分析技术,可以实时监控网络流量,并生成详细的流量统计报告;
  • sFlow:sFlow是一种基于采样技术的网络流量监测方法,可以高效地监控网络流量。

  1. 性能监控工具

性能监控工具可以帮助管理员实时监控网络性能,常见的性能监控工具有:

  • Nagios:Nagios是一款开源的网络监控工具,可以监控服务器、网络设备、应用程序等;
  • Zabbix:Zabbix是一款开源的监控解决方案,可以监控网络、服务器、应用程序等;
  • Prometheus:Prometheus是一款开源的监控和告警工具,可以监控各种类型的指标。

三、案例分析

以下是一个网络性能监测的案例分析:

某企业网络出现故障,导致员工无法正常访问公司内部系统。管理员使用Ping测试发现,与故障设备之间的延迟较高,且丢包率较高。通过Traceroute发现,故障发生在网络链路的一个节点上。管理员使用流量监测工具发现,该节点上的流量异常,导致网络拥塞。最终,管理员通过更换故障设备,解决了网络故障。

四、总结

网络性能监测是确保网络稳定运行的重要手段。通过采用合适的监测方法,管理员可以及时发现网络问题,并采取措施解决。在实际应用中,应根据网络环境和需求选择合适的监测方法,以确保网络性能的稳定。

猜你喜欢:微服务监控